Transaction f44a7bc9c0c5337e8d950f2b26576710935d47416429d67bece0360efce1b32d
1 Input
1 Outputs
- f44a7bc9c0c5337e8d950f2b26576710935d47416429d67bece0360efce1b32d:0
value 3586727
address 1Duyo4N8kYYEqzYwt6fgckqbnpTxD3dqQd